如何通过Java电商项目实现个性化推荐,提升用户购物体验?

2026-04-12 16:061阅读0评论SEO基础
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计895个文字,预计阅读时间需要4分钟。

如何通过Java电商项目实现个性化推荐,提升用户购物体验?

实现Java电商项目功能,作为一名经验丰富的开发者,我将指导一位初入行的小白如何实现一个Java电商项目的功能。在整个过程中,我们将使用一些关键的代码来完成特定的任务。

实现Java电商项目功能话术

作为一名经验丰富的开发者,我将会指导一位刚入行的小白如何实现一个Java电商项目的功能。在整个过程中,我们将会使用到一些关键的代码来完成特定的任务。以下是整个实现过程的流程图:

classDiagram class 小白开发者{ +学习() +编码() +测试() +部署() } class Java电商项目{ +Java电商项目() +用户管理模块() +商品管理模块() +购物车模块() +订单管理模块() } class 学习{ +学习Java() +学习Web开发() +学习Spring框架() +学习数据库设计() } class 编码{ +用户登录() +用户注册() +商品展示() +购物车操作() +下单操作() } class 测试{ +用户登录() +用户注册() +商品展示() +购物车操作() +下单操作() } class 部署{ +将代码部署到服务器() +配置数据库连接() +启动应用() } 小白开发者 --> 学习 小白开发者 --> 编码 小白开发者 --> 测试 小白开发者 --> 部署 Java电商项目 --> 用户管理模块 Java电商项目 --> 商品管理模块 Java电商项目 --> 购物车模块 Java电商项目 --> 订单管理模块

根据流程图,我们可以分解出以下步骤来实现Java电商项目的功能:

  1. 学习Java、Web开发、Spring框架和数据库设计。这些知识将为我们后续的开发工作提供基础。
  2. 实现用户管理模块,包括用户登录和注册功能。这些功能将用于用户的身份验证和管理。下面是用户登录的代码:

public class UserController { // 用户登录 public String login(String username, String password) { // 验证用户 if (username.equals("admin") && password.equals("password")) { return "登录成功"; } else { return "用户名或密码错误"; } } }

  1. 实现商品管理模块,包括商品展示功能。这些功能将用于展示和管理商城中的商品信息。下面是展示商品的代码:

public class ProductController { // 展示商品 public List<Product> getProducts() { // 查询数据库获取商品列表 List<Product> products = productService.getProducts(); return products; } }

  1. 实现购物车模块,包括购物车添加、删除和展示功能。这些功能将用于用户管理购物车中的商品。下面是添加商品到购物车的代码:

public class CartController { // 添加商品到购物车 public void addToCart(Product product, int quantity) { // 添加商品到购物车 CartItem item = new CartItem(product, quantity); cartService.addToCart(item); } }

  1. 实现订单管理模块,包括下单和订单展示功能。这些功能将用于用户下单和查询订单信息。下面是用户下单的代码:

public class OrderController { // 下单 public String placeOrder(List<CartItem> items) { // 处理下单逻辑 orderService.placeOrder(items); return "下单成功"; } }

以上是实现Java电商项目功能的主要步骤和代码示例。通过学习和实践,小白开发者将能够掌握这些关键的开发技能,并能够成功实现一个功能完善的Java电商项目。

如何通过Java电商项目实现个性化推荐,提升用户购物体验?

希望这篇文章能对你有所帮助,祝你在开发过程中取得成功!

本文共计895个文字,预计阅读时间需要4分钟。

如何通过Java电商项目实现个性化推荐,提升用户购物体验?

实现Java电商项目功能,作为一名经验丰富的开发者,我将指导一位初入行的小白如何实现一个Java电商项目的功能。在整个过程中,我们将使用一些关键的代码来完成特定的任务。

实现Java电商项目功能话术

作为一名经验丰富的开发者,我将会指导一位刚入行的小白如何实现一个Java电商项目的功能。在整个过程中,我们将会使用到一些关键的代码来完成特定的任务。以下是整个实现过程的流程图:

classDiagram class 小白开发者{ +学习() +编码() +测试() +部署() } class Java电商项目{ +Java电商项目() +用户管理模块() +商品管理模块() +购物车模块() +订单管理模块() } class 学习{ +学习Java() +学习Web开发() +学习Spring框架() +学习数据库设计() } class 编码{ +用户登录() +用户注册() +商品展示() +购物车操作() +下单操作() } class 测试{ +用户登录() +用户注册() +商品展示() +购物车操作() +下单操作() } class 部署{ +将代码部署到服务器() +配置数据库连接() +启动应用() } 小白开发者 --> 学习 小白开发者 --> 编码 小白开发者 --> 测试 小白开发者 --> 部署 Java电商项目 --> 用户管理模块 Java电商项目 --> 商品管理模块 Java电商项目 --> 购物车模块 Java电商项目 --> 订单管理模块

根据流程图,我们可以分解出以下步骤来实现Java电商项目的功能:

  1. 学习Java、Web开发、Spring框架和数据库设计。这些知识将为我们后续的开发工作提供基础。
  2. 实现用户管理模块,包括用户登录和注册功能。这些功能将用于用户的身份验证和管理。下面是用户登录的代码:

public class UserController { // 用户登录 public String login(String username, String password) { // 验证用户 if (username.equals("admin") && password.equals("password")) { return "登录成功"; } else { return "用户名或密码错误"; } } }

  1. 实现商品管理模块,包括商品展示功能。这些功能将用于展示和管理商城中的商品信息。下面是展示商品的代码:

public class ProductController { // 展示商品 public List<Product> getProducts() { // 查询数据库获取商品列表 List<Product> products = productService.getProducts(); return products; } }

  1. 实现购物车模块,包括购物车添加、删除和展示功能。这些功能将用于用户管理购物车中的商品。下面是添加商品到购物车的代码:

public class CartController { // 添加商品到购物车 public void addToCart(Product product, int quantity) { // 添加商品到购物车 CartItem item = new CartItem(product, quantity); cartService.addToCart(item); } }

  1. 实现订单管理模块,包括下单和订单展示功能。这些功能将用于用户下单和查询订单信息。下面是用户下单的代码:

public class OrderController { // 下单 public String placeOrder(List<CartItem> items) { // 处理下单逻辑 orderService.placeOrder(items); return "下单成功"; } }

以上是实现Java电商项目功能的主要步骤和代码示例。通过学习和实践,小白开发者将能够掌握这些关键的开发技能,并能够成功实现一个功能完善的Java电商项目。

如何通过Java电商项目实现个性化推荐,提升用户购物体验?

希望这篇文章能对你有所帮助,祝你在开发过程中取得成功!